The NFL pushed a pretty major update to its "NFL '12" app last night that brings some pretty nice features for anyone who uses the app:

What's in this version:

- All new Thursday Night Football Xtra companion experience

- Completely redesigned Videos section (Android tablet only)

- Access to the NFL.com/Live look-in show for TNF (Android tablet only)

- Ability to share all your favorite News

- Added more stats

- Bug fixes

So, what's the problem? You probably can't use it. Out of the 19 devices listed on my Google account, it's only compatible with one. The sad part is, it probably won't really work on that one - it's the AMP1000, which shows as compatible with nearly every app I look at, even when they won't work. It's pretty weird, actually. Similarly, the app is only available on two of Artem's devices, and they're both phones.
